The Covert Threats of Refractive Surgery



While many individuals look for refractive surgery for clearer vision, it's essential to understand the surprise dangers included.

You may experience difficulties like dry eyes, glare, or halos around lights, which can influence your day-to-day tasks. There's likewise an opportunity that your vision will not enhance as anticipated, or it might also worsen.

Browsing the Recovery Refine



As you browse the recovery process after refractive surgical treatment, it's necessary to follow your surgeon's guidelines carefully to ensure the very best feasible end result.

You'll likely experience some discomfort and obscured vision originally, which is regular. Relax your eyes as much as possible, preventing screens and brilliant lights for the first couple of days.

Do not fail to remember to utilize the suggested eye goes down to avoid dryness and advertise healing. Put on sunglasses outdoors to protect your eyes from UV rays.

It's critical to prevent scrubing your eyes and adhere to any task restrictions your specialist suggests, particularly in the first week.



Keep all follow-up appointments to check your recovery progress, and don't wait to connect to your specialist with any kind of concerns.
